Output 6d6a317af182714d820a21d2f69547c7a65311fe17f897c7af3bf2dc17c6ce99:26

value
11247823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b03db536a80b9b5bb3f52c0dcd1c20f9c47413 OP_EQUAL
address
MTZce7hWGYbT7AUTq63BzC6rnXzNzxPg6A
transaction
6d6a317af182714d820a21d2f69547c7a65311fe17f897c7af3bf2dc17c6ce99
spent
true